Securing Your CMS

Security is a critical aspect of managing a CMS. Regular updates, strong passwords, and user permissions are essential to protect your site from vulnerabilities. Implementing security plugins can also enhance your site's defenses.

Regular Backups

Always maintain regular backups of your content and database. This practice ensures that you can restore your site quickly in case of a security breach or data loss.
